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 30 Minutes |
Ready In: 50 Minutes Servings: 16 |
|
this is a wonderful recipe to make and give in a basket at Christmas time. It is so sweet and moist they want last long! This recipe came from my daughter-inlaws Mom who is so generous with her recipes. Ingredients:
3 cups self-rising flour |
1 teaspoon cinnamon |
2 eggs |
1 cup white raisins, optional |
1 teaspoon vanilla |
2 cups sugar |
1 cup cooking oil |
2 cups mashed sweet potatoes |
1 cup chopped pecans |
Directions:
1. Mix flour,sugar and cinnamon together and stir well. 2. Mix in cooking oil and eggs; stir in sweet potatoes, raisins, vanilla and nuts. 3. Line muffin tin with paper liners. 4. Fill about 1/2 full. 5. Bake at 350 degrees for 30 min. 6. The muffin mixture will keep in refrig for 3 days. |
